On the discipline of testing assumptions before building products. Why patience and validation beat speed every time.

The Temptation to Build

Every product person has felt it — that irresistible urge to start building the moment an idea takes shape. The wireframes practically draw themselves. The architecture crystallizes in your mind. You can see the finished product so clearly that building it feels like a formality.

This is the most dangerous moment in product development.

What Testing Really Means

Testing assumptions isn't about running surveys or building MVPs. It's about finding the fastest way to be wrong. The goal is to identify the riskiest assumption in your plan and design the cheapest possible experiment to validate or kill it.

The discipline is in what you don't build. Every feature you ship before validating the core assumption is waste. Every line of code written before talking to customers is a liability.